How much do auto dealership driver j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for auto dealership driver in Indiana is $31,296.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$28,500.00 and $36,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ges Auto Dealership Drivers face during their shifts?

Auto Dealership Drivers often encounter challenges such as navigating busy traffic, ensuring the safe handling of a variety of vehicle makes and models, and maintaining punctuality for scheduled deliveries or pickups. Weather conditions and last-minute schedule changes can also add complexity to the role. Effective communication with the sales and service teams is crucial to coordinate vehicle movements and prevent delays, making adaptability and time management key skills for success in this position.

What is the difference between Auto Dealership Driver vs Delivery Driver?

AspectAuto Dealership DriverDelivery Driver
Required CredentialsDriver's license, clean driving recordDriver's license, sometimes special certifications for certain deliveries
Work EnvironmentAuto dealership lot, showroom, or service areaVarious locations, including homes, businesses, and warehouses
Employer & Industry UsageAuto dealerships, car rental companiesRetail, food service, logistics companies

Auto Dealership Drivers primarily transport vehicles within dealership premises or to customers, focusing on vehicle delivery and pickup. Delivery Drivers handle a broader range of items, delivering goods to customers at various locations. While both roles require a valid driver's license and good driving skills, Auto Dealership Drivers typically work within a dealership environment, whereas Delivery Drivers operate across different locations, often with more varied routes.

What are Auto Dealership Drivers?

Auto Dealership Drivers are employees who are responsible for transporting vehicles to and from dealerships, service centers, auctions, or customers. Their duties often include driving new or used cars between locations, performing basic vehicle inspections, and ensuring cars are handled safely and professionally. They may also assist with vehicle organization on dealership lots, keep records of deliveries, and occasionally help with customer service. This role typically requires a valid driver’s license, a clean driving record, and strong attention to detail. It can be a good entry-level position for those interested in the automotive industry.

What Does an Auto Dealership Driver Do?

An auto dealership driver is a dynamic role that combines customer service with maintenance and any other ad hoc duties assigned. In addition to greeting customers as they arrive and directing them to the right service advisors, your responsibilities include transporting customers and employees between dealerships and other destinations. Dealership service shops rely on drivers to move cars in and out of service bays and keep vehicle lots neat, and you may move units to create new displays. Larger automotive groups may require you to drive a courtesy shuttle between dealerships or around the lot.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Auto Dealership Driver,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Auto Dealership Driver, you need a valid driver's license, a clean driving record, and knowledge of safe vehicle operation.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ems and dealership inventory management tools is often required. Reliability, professionalism, and strong customer service skills help drivers interact effectively with clients and staff. These abilities are crucial for ensuring timely, safe vehicle deliveries and maintaining the dealership’s reputation.

Job Description:
The Porter complements quality repairs by cleaning customer vehicles prior to vehicle delivery. Maintains the appearance and cleanliness of shop and office facilities.
Key Job Responsibilities
  • Ensure consistent execution of WOW (Wow Operating Way) plan.
  • Maintain the daily housekeeping of the interior of the office, including daily emptying of garbage cans, cleaning the floors, and dusting the countertops and work area.
  • Maintain the daily housekeeping of the interior of the production area, emptying of waste cans, sweeping the floors, disposing of unwanted vehicle parts, and placing tools and equipment in their proper location.
  • Maintain parking lots and grounds in a neat and orderly fashion, including shoveling sidewalks when necessary
  • Pre-washes customer vehicles prior to repairs beginning.
  • Exterior and interior cleanup of customer vehicles after repairs are complete
  • Transport of customer vehicles to sublet locations for repairs
